This : This is a general surgery question not orthopedics. You should consult a general surgeon to discuss the situation. It is not common for a female to have an inguinal hernia. The canal being smaller may put you at a higher risk of incarceration of the hernia. That would be an emergency situation.

Should be fine: Base your activity level on your discomfort level. You should be fine if it doesn't bother you. At some point however, you should see a general surgeon with experience in both open and laparoscopic hernia repair as we think that hernias are riskier to leave alone in women compared to men.
